Name of the Vulnerable Software and Affected Versions EasyImageCatalogue version 1.3.1
Description The issue allows remote attackers to inject arbitrary web script or HTML, potentially leading to cross-site scripting (XSS) attacks. This can be achieved via several parameters, including the search and d index.php parameters to "index.php", the dir parameter to "thumber.php", and the d parameter to "describe.php" and "addcomment.php".
Recommendations For EasyImageCatalogue version 1.3.1, consider validating and sanitizing user input for the search, d, and dir parameters in the affected scripts to prevent arbitrary script or HTML injection. As a temporary workaround, restrict access to the vulnerable scripts until a patch is available.
